Mediafly Receives $25M Investment

Published: January 29, 2021

Mediafly, a sales enablement and content management platform, completed a $25 million growth round of funding. The round was led by existing investors Boathouse Capital, which provided equity, and Sterling National Bank, which provided senior debt.

The company plans to use the funds to improve its product and market position and increase team resources across the entire organization. Key areas of focus include product innovation, global sales expansion, customer success, consulting services and marketing.
